I've been driving the VV7 for almost three years now. The fuel consumption during daily city commuting is indeed quite high, averaging 13 to 15 liters per 100 kilometers, and can spike above 16L in heavy traffic. On highways, it drops back to 11-12L which is relatively more economical. As an owner, I believe driving habits make a big difference - frequent hard acceleration and braking consumes more fuel, while maintaining a steady speed can reduce consumption by 1-2 liters. Regular maintenance is crucial too - changing engine oil, air filters, checking tire pressure, etc. A well-maintained car naturally has better fuel efficiency. Although the VV7 is an SUV with spacious interior and stable driving experience, you should budget for fuel costs. I recommend test driving extensively before purchase to experience the real-world fuel consumption, rather than relying solely on official figures that might affect your daily usage planning.

From an automotive enthusiast's perspective on the VV7's fuel consumption, this vehicle is equipped with a 2.0T engine with ample power, delivering an actual fuel consumption of approximately 12-15L/100km. It consumes the most fuel in urban areas, with slightly better efficiency on highways. Personal experience shows that flooring the accelerator increases fuel consumption, so it's recommended to use smooth starts and keep the RPM within the economical range below 2000. Minor adjustments like tire wear and drag coefficient can slightly reduce fuel consumption, while proper maintenance and carbon deposit cleaning benefit engine efficiency. Overall, this performance-oriented vehicle has relatively high fuel consumption, but it's more fuel-efficient on long trips compared to city driving.

What type of driver's license does A3 downgrade to?

A3 driver's license downgrade will be downgraded to a C1 driver's license. C1 driver's license generally refers to the C1 driving license. C1 driving license is one of the codes for motor vehicle driving licenses. The permitted driving level of a C1 driving license includes (all models of C2, C3, C4) small and micro passenger vehicles, light and micro cargo vehicles, light, small, and micro special operation vehicles, etc. Additional information: Drivers holding a large passenger vehicle, tractor, city bus, medium passenger vehicle, or large truck driver's license who meet any of the following conditions shall have their highest permitted driving qualification revoked by the vehicle management office, and the motor vehicle driver shall be notified to complete the downgrade and license replacement procedures within 30 days: 1. Being involved in a traffic accident resulting in death and bearing equal or greater responsibility without constituting a crime; 2. Having a full 12-point record within one scoring cycle; 3. Failing to participate in the inspection for three consecutive scoring cycles.

What causes a loud noise when shifting into reverse without depressing the clutch?

If you shift gears without depressing the clutch, the transmission will experience gear grinding, and the loud noise heard at the moment of shifting is the sound of the transmission gears grinding. Therefore, it is essential to avoid gear grinding while driving. Frequent gear grinding can lead to gear wear in mild cases and may require a major transmission overhaul in severe cases. Below are detailed explanations about this issue: 1. Explanation one: It is relatively common for manual transmission vehicles to produce such abnormal noises when shifting directly into reverse without depressing the clutch. This sound is caused by poor gear meshing and generally does not significantly affect the vehicle under normal usage. 2. Explanation two: The internal structure of a manual transmission includes a very important component called the "synchronizer." The role of the synchronizer is to transfer power from the output gear to the gear being engaged during shifting. Without a synchronizer, forcing a slowly rotating gear into a rapidly rotating one will inevitably result in gear grinding.
